## Studio Access — Recording Suite B

The Vexley training studio (Level 3, past the kit lockers) is restricted. Reception issues day passes only; no escorting visitors inside. Bookings go through Mirella on the content team. Keep the door shut — it's soundproofed for a reason. Use the code below to unlock the studio door.

badge for fafop-fajof: bdg-Z-47

Subject: DR drill — Nightglass scheduler, Thursday

Plugin authors: we're failing over the Nightglass backfill scheduler to the Tern Hollow standby cluster Thursday 02:00. Expect one skipped nightly run. Plugins must tolerate duplicate job IDs on resume. Test against the staging sandbox beforehand. To restore your plugin's state vault after failover, you will need the recovery passphrase, which is:

vault phrase of bagaf-kajeg = jorath-feniel-briir-siliel-ralix

**How does pagination work in the Thrumbird API?**

Short version: cursors, not page numbers. Every list endpoint returns a `next_cursor` token when more results exist; pass it back as the `cursor` query param. Don't try to construct cursors yourself — they're opaque and we rotate the encoding without warning. Page size maxes out at 100, defaults to 25. If `next_cursor` is absent, you've hit the end. Rate limits apply per cursor walk, so cache aggressively. Full examples in several languages are collected on the page below.

dashboard of bafof-hafog = https://confluence.lumiclabs.internal/display/browse/display/6a09a20a

Telemetry payloads from Quillgate agents must be compressed before upload to the Marrow ingest tier. Reviewers should confirm that batches exceeding the raw-size ceiling are split rather than truncated, and that the compressor falls back to identity encoding when ratios are poor. The enforced limits and compression thresholds are defined in the constants below.

tuning table, fawep-fajof:
QUOTAS = {
    "druael": 2,
    "holwyn": 5,
    "ulaix": 2,
    "druix": 2,
}